A video of the opening of a Liberal campaign office in Melbourne has ended up looking like a booze ad, with alcohol clutched by guests catching the eye 23 times in 96 seconds. The film was made for Liberal hopeful Kevin Ekendahl, who is contesting the ALP seat Melbourne Ports. Mr Ekendahl said the video didn't reflect the reality of the party and that "there wasn't much [alcohol] at all actually."
